Assembly elections are in full swing in Jharkhand, Election Commission team will come on a two-day visit on 23 September

Ranchi: The buzz of assembly elections has started in Jharkhand. It is being said that assembly elections may be held in the state in November-December. The team of Election Commission of India will come to Ranchi on a two-day visit on 23 September to review the election preparations.
The Election Commission's team will include Chief Election Commissioner Rajiv Kumar, Election Commissioner Gyanesh Kumar and Sukhvir Singh Sindhu, including about a dozen officers. The state's Chief Electoral Officer's office has been informed about this.

The team will reach Ranchi on 23 September at 9 am. Here it will hold a meeting with the representatives of national and state political parties. Representatives of BJP, Congress, JMM, RJD, AAP, National People's Party, CPIM, AJSU and BSP will be included in this. After this, there will be a meeting with the enforcement agencies, which will include officials from ED, Narcotics, Railways and Airport. On the very first day, there will be a meeting with the Chief Electoral Officer and Nodal Police Officer of the state. Information about election preparations will be shared in this. After this, there will be a separate meeting with the Chief Secretary and DGP. On September 24, the team of the Commission will hold a meeting with the DC, IG, DIG, SSP and SP of all the districts. On the information of the arrival of the team, the Chief Electoral Officer of the state, Ravi Kumar, held a meeting on Friday regarding the preparations.
